When someone asks why people do 'bodybuilding' it is as skeptical as asking why get an education. The reply to both the question is to improve oneself. Maybe individual's insight of a bodybuilder applies just to those guys who compete in the 'National-Level' competition or are displayed on the cover-page of the muscle-magazines. 'Bodybuilding' is not restricted to them; it includes the leisure gym rat who just wants have good looks in his Speedo's in the local-pool.
Moreover the noticeable health-benefits, 'bodybuilding' is the closest thing available to the youth. There are also benefits that cannot be measured: self-discipline, esteem of others and self-confidence, because we are often judged primarily on our looks. In simple, the advantages both intangible & tangible far overshadow what minor incontinences there may be of going to the gymnasium & getting sweaty, sore & hot.

The 'Bodybuilding-World' can be a complex one, in particular for a beginner. What type of exercise to do? How many reps? Which routine? How many sets? What to eat? And so on. There is also contradictory info. and diverse methods. Primarily let us not kid ourselves. 'Bodybuilding' is about 'Re-sculpturing' your body to any degree that you wish & is going to take a lot of hard work & determination, nothing in life is easy. The rest is 'common-sense'.
